Strongest Liverpool Lineup To Face Bournemouth
After some great results in the last couple of weeks, Liverpool will be travelling to Vitality Stadium to face Bournemouth. Bournemouth has been a surprise package this year as they are currently sitting at 11th position in Barclays Premier League.
Liverpool will be doing everything in their remaining fixtures to make sure that they qualify for Europe next season. Here is the predicted lineup for Liverpool that could face Bournemouth this Sunday-
The only senior and experienced goalkeeper Klopp has is Mignolet. The Belgian has faced a lot of criticism in the recent weeks due to his poor goalkeeping skill but, is improving under the guidance of the new manager.
Klopp might play the same fullbacks in his game but might change the center back partnership. He chose Toure and Skrtel in his last premier league game and the duo did a great job to deny Shaqiri and Arnautovic but failed to stop Bojan from scoring. Sakho is his first choice center back this season but, he might give an another try by using Skrtel alongside him. Moreno is doing a great job, he is quick and is an offensive fullback and he scored a screamer against Stoke last time out.
With the absence of Emre Can, Joe Allen is expected to start. Milner is a tireless worker for the team and is a deserving candidate to partner the Welsh midfielder in the pivot. Coutinho will surely be deployed on the left wing and Firmino might start the game as an attacking midfielder.
Since both the strikers are in a good goal scoring touch at the moment, the best idea is to start both. Maybe Daniel can play a second striker role, dropping bit deep to get the ball from the midfield while Origi should be the main target man for the Reds.
